A student in my summer stats class competed in the Strike King Bassmaster College National Championship. I created a graph of the top 50 for them. The data is super interesting. The top 11 are clear outliers and separating themselves from the lower 39.

Update: My student let me know that those people were the only ones that qualified for day 3 - thus the reason for them being outliers. Also, there was a 5 fish limit each day. Here is the top 50 after two days, purple stars qualified for day 3.

Had students pick a song and use the lyric words lengths to create a game. I noticed that a spinner can really support the idea a discrete probability distribution. Before I would only show the graph (x, P(x)).

What is your style for a t or z test? I like to show the distribution centered at the null. Centering at zero and using standard deviations feels like an outdated way of using tables. But maybe I am missing some thing? Which diagram would you want @desmos to show?
